fbpx

2019 完整的 React 開發者課程 (包含 Redux,Hooks,GraphQL)

課程簡介

成為一名高階的 React 開發人員! 用 Redux,Hooks,GraphQL,ContextAPI,Stripe,Firebase 開發一個龐大的電子商務應用程式

課程介紹:English 简中

從這 37.5 小時的課程,你會學到

  • 建立企業級 React 應用程式並部署到營運環境
  • 學習如何像高階開發人員一樣構建反應型、效能型、大規模的應用程式
  • 學習最新的 React 特性,包括 Hooks,Context API,Suspense,React Lazy + 更多
  • 從零開始掌握 React 開發者的最新生態系統
  • 成為前 10% 的 ReactJS 開發者
  • 使用 GraphQL 的 React 開發人員
  • 在你的應用程式中使用 Redux,Redux Thunk 和 Redux Saga
  • 當涉及到不同的狀態管理時,學會比較如何取捨
  • 設定身份驗證和使用者帳戶
  • 使用 Firebase 建立一個全端的應用程式
  • 通過做出良好的架構決策和幫助團隊中的其他人來學會領導 React 專案
  • 掌握 React 設計模式
  • 使用 styled-components 學習 CSS in JS
  • 使用 React Router 做路由
  • 將應用程式轉換為漸進式 Web 應用程式 ( PWA )
  • 使用 Jest、 Enzyme 和 snapshot 測試應用程式
  • 使用 Stripe API 處理線上支付
  • 使用最新的 ES6/ES7/ES8/ES9 JavaScript 編寫乾淨的程式碼

要求

  • 基本的 HTML,CSS 和 JavaScript 知識
  • 你不需要有 React 或任何其它 JS 框架的經驗

課程說明

加入一個由超過10萬名開發人員組成的線上社群,以及一個由實際在矽谷和多倫多使用 React.js 工作過的專家教授的課程。 這是一個全新的課程剛剛在2019年7月釋出

使用最新版本的 React: 16.8 + ,這個課程的重點是效率。 不要再把時間花在令人困惑的、過時的、不完整的教程上了。 Andrei 的課程畢業生現在在 Google,Amazon,Apple,IBM,JP Morgan,Facebook,以及其它頂尖的科技公司工作

我們保證這是最全面的線上 React 學習資源。 這個基於專案的課程將向你介紹 React 開發人員的所有最新的工具鏈。 一路走來,我們將建立一個類似 Shopify 的大規模電子商務應用程式,使用 React,Redux,React Hooks,React Router,GraphQL,Context API,Firebase,Redux-saga,Stripe + 更多。 這將是一個使用 Firebase 完整的全端應用程式(MERN 堆疊) ,。

課程將是非常實際的,因為我們帶你從開始到結束發佈一個專業的 React 專案到進入營運的所有的方法。 我們將從一開始教你 React 基礎,然後進入高階主題,這樣你就可以在任何未來的 ReactJS 專案中對架構和工具做出正確的決定。

所有的程式碼將一步一步地提供,即使你不喜歡編寫程式,你將獲得完整的主專案程式碼,所以任何註冊課程的人將馬上有自己的專案放在自己的作品組合。 主題包括:

– React 基礎

– React Router

– React 路由器

– Redux

– Redux Saga

– 非同步 Redux

– React Hooks

– Context API

– React Suspense + React Lazy

– Firebase

– Stripe API

– Styled-Components

– GraphQL

– Apollo

– PWAs

– React 效能

– React 設計模式

– 使用 Jest,Enzyme、和 Snapshot 做測試

– React 最佳實踐

– Persistance + Session Storage

– 狀態標準化

還有更多!

等等,我知道你在想什麼。 為什麼我們不建 10 個以上的專案? 好吧,事實是: 大多數課程教你 React 並且只是動手做。 他們向你展示了如何開始,建立10個簡單容易使用的專案,只需新增一些 CSS 就可以讓它們看起來很漂亮。 但是在真實生活中,你不需要構建愚蠢的應用程式。 當你申請工作的時候,沒有人會在意你建立了一個漂亮的待辦事項應用程式。 僱主希望看到你開發能夠擴展,有良好的架構,並且可以部署到營運環境中的大型應用程式。

讓我告訴你為什麼這門課不同於其它任何線上教程的三個原因

  1. 你將構建你將在任何課程中看到的最大的專案。 這種類型的專案你自己實現會花費你幾個月的時間。
  2. 這門課程是由兩位實際為一些大型的科技公司工作過的導師教授的,他們使用的是 營運中的 React。 Yihua 一直致力於一些大型電子商務網站的工作,這些網站你肯定聽說過,也可能已經在上面購買過。 Andrei 曾經為矽谷和多倫多的大型已上市的公司提供企業級的 React 應用程式。 通過讓他們兩個教導,你可以看到不同的角度,並從兩個高階開發人員那裡學習,就好像你們在一個公司一起工作一樣。
  3. 我們學習的原則比你作為一個初學者學到的東西更重要。 利用講師的經驗,你學習設計模式,如何構建你的應用程式,組織你的程式碼,構建你的資料夾,以及如何考慮效能。 這麼說吧,我們不迴避高階主題。

這個課程不是讓你在沒有理解原則的情況下編寫程式碼,這樣當你完成這個課程的時候,除非看另一個課程,你就不知道該做什麼了。 不! 本課程將推動你和挑戰你從一個絕對的 React 初學者到前 10% 的 React 開發人員

目標受眾

  • 對超越普通“初學者”課程感興趣的學生
  • 想要學習 Web 開發人員最需要的技能的程式設計師
  • 想進入前10% 的 React 開發者的人
  • 希望獲得可擴展的大型應用程式工作經驗的學生
  • 想要超越基礎的訓練營或線上課程畢業生

講師簡介

Andrei Neagoie 由高階軟體開發人員轉為講師 ( 更多講師主講課程介紹 )

Andrei 是 Udemy 網頁程式開發課程評價很高的教師,也是成長最快的教師之一。 他的畢業生已經進入世界上一些最大的科技公司工作,比如蘋果、谷歌、摩根大通、 IBM 等等。 . 多年來,他一直在矽谷和多倫多擔任高階軟體開發人員,現在正在利用他所學到的一切,來教授程式設計技能,並幫助你發現作為一名開發人員在生活中所能提供的驚人的就業機會。

作為一個自學的程式設計師,他知道有大量的線上課程、教程和書籍過於冗長,不足以教授正確的技能。 大多數人在學習一個複雜的主題時會感到麻痺,不知道從哪裡開始,或者更糟糕的是,大多數人沒有20,000美元用於程式設計訓練營。 程式設計技能學習應該是所有人可以負擔的起,並且對所有人開放。 教材應該教授現代生活技能,不應該浪費學生寶貴的時間。 Andrei 從為財富500強企業、科技創業公司工作中學到了重要的經驗,甚至開創了自己的事業,他現在 100% 地投入時間教授其他人有價值的軟體開發技能,以便掌控他們的生活,在一個充滿無限可能性且激動人心的行業中工作。

Andrei 向你保證,沒有其它課程有這麼全面和詳細的解釋。 他認為,為了學習任何有價值的東西,你需要從基礎開始,發展樹的根本。 只有從那裡你才能學到與基礎相關的概念和具體技能(葉子)。 當以這種方式建立時,學習將會呈現指數級的成長。

以他的教育心理學和程式設計經驗,Andrei 的課程將帶你瞭解複雜的主題,你從來沒有想過是可能的。

課程中見!

Yihua Zhang 資深軟體開發人員

Yihua Zhang 是 Zero To Mastery 的教練之一,這是 Udemy 上評價最高、發展最快的網頁開發學院之一。 多年來,他一直在多倫多為一些世界上最大的科技公司從事軟體開發工作。 他還做了十多年的教練。 他專注於用他所學到的一切幫助你成為一名開發人員,同時也給你在這個令人難以置信蓬勃發展的行業中所需要的所有基本技能。

Yihua 是一名自學成的開發者,所以他完全理解來自不同背景的人進入這個行業的挑戰和心態。 他一直在桌子的兩邊,作為一個教師和學生無數次,所以他可以理解學習新的東西和挑戰的困難。 學習本身就是一種需要練習和提升的技能,他致力於幫助你自己提升和掌握這種技能。 課程需要實用,你需要能夠理解為什麼你在學習你所學的東西。 你需要在知道解決方案之前瞭解問題,他很自豪地教你如何構建專業的、真實世界的應用程式,這樣你才能真正理解為什麼你要用一種特殊的方法做事。 他會教你儘快成為一名開發人員所需要的思維方式和技能,這樣你就可以擁有豐富和充實的生活。

Yihua 的課程將引導你構建文字精美、功能豐富的應用程式,同時真正理解你在這個過程中將遇到的所有複雜概念。

課堂上見!

英文字幕:有

  • 想要了解如何將英文字幕自動翻譯成中文? 請參考這篇 How-To

優惠資訊

如何購買這門課程比較划算?可以參考課程優惠折扣連結


報名參加課程

Sponsored by Udemy

也許你會有興趣

 學習資訊不漏接-歡迎使用 App 訂閱發文通知 

Spread the love

這個網站採用 Akismet 服務減少垃圾留言。進一步瞭解 Akismet 如何處理網站訪客的留言資料

Powered by WordPress.com.

Up ↑

%d 位部落客按了讚: